The England Lionesses are one of the most exciting and successful national football teams in women’s sports today. As they continue to make waves on the international stage, discussions surrounding their future performance, sponsorship deals, and overall development are inevitable. When it comes to considering whether the team’s loss or win will be a factor in securing significant deals, there are three main aspects to consider: performance on the pitch, commercial appeal, and the growing investment in women’s football.

1. Performance on the Pitch:

Undoubtedly, the Lionesses’ performance on the field plays a huge role in securing lucrative deals, both in terms of sponsorship and broader commercial success. Success in major tournaments, like the UEFA Women’s Euro and the FIFA Women’s World Cup, directly impacts their visibility and marketability. Winning these high-profile tournaments elevates the team’s profile globally, attracting major brands eager to align with successful athletes. However, even in defeat, the team’s resilience and ability to maintain competitive performances can also create opportunities, especially if they show growth, skill, and heart. Consistency in performance—whether through wins or losses—can keep sponsors invested, knowing the team is always in the spotlight.

2. Commercial Appeal:

Sponsorships and commercial deals often depend on the team’s public profile and fan engagement. The Lionesses have significantly grown their brand in recent years, with high attendance rates at matches, millions of social media followers, and widespread national pride. A win, especially in a major tournament, further strengthens this appeal, drawing in global sponsors who want to tap into the women’s sports market. On the other hand, a loss in a big competition doesn’t necessarily mean the end of commercial opportunities. The Lionesses have built an emotional connection with their fans, which can sustain commercial interest even when the team doesn’t win. Companies look for teams with high engagement levels, and the Lionesses consistently deliver in that area.

3. Investment in Women’s Football:

The continued growth of women’s football in England and globally is another key factor to consider. Investment from the FA, clubs, and other football organizations in developing the game ensures that the Lionesses remain in the spotlight. Sponsorship deals and TV contracts are becoming more lucrative due to the increasing interest in the women’s game, meaning that both wins and losses can still lead to big deals. The recent rise of the Women’s Super League (WSL) has also paved the way for better financial backing, increasing the value of players and the national team. Regardless of the outcome in international competitions, the ongoing investment in women’s football ensures that opportunities will continue to be on the table for the Lionesses.

In conclusion, while a win or loss on the pitch undoubtedly impacts the England Lionesses’ marketability and future deals, it is only one factor among many. Performance, commercial appeal, and the growing investment in women’s football all play a crucial role in the team’s future success, both on and off the field. The Lionesses have solidified their place as one of the most influential teams in the world of women’s sport, and regardless of any single result, their commercial potential remains as strong as ever.
